The Ultimate Guide to Using a Marine Parts Directory for Boat Repairs
Recent Trends
Boat owners and repair shops are increasingly turning to digital marine parts directories to identify and source components. The shift follows supply-chain pressure on traditional brick-and-mortar dealers and a growing inventory of older vessels that require cross-referencing of discontinued or superseded parts. Mobile-first platforms and barcode scanning tools have made these directories more accessible during actual repairs.

- Integration with OEM databases to show real-time stock levels and alternate part numbers.
- Use of image recognition to match parts from photographs taken aboard.
- Rise of community-curated catalogs that supplement manufacturer listings for out-of-production models.
Background
Marine parts directories have evolved from printed catalogs issued by engine and hull builders to aggregated online databases. Early digital versions were often static PDFs or limited to a single brand. Today’s directories combine multiple manufacturers, aftermarket suppliers, and user-submitted fitment notes. The need for a unified reference grew as boat designs became more complex and as owners sought to keep aging boats running rather than replacing them.

- Search by model year, serial number, or component specification.
- Cross-reference between original equipment and generic alternatives.
- Historical archives for parts that are no longer actively produced.
User Concerns
While a marine parts directory can streamline repairs, users raise several practical issues. Accuracy of fitment data remains inconsistent, especially for hybrid systems or custom installations. Some directories charge subscription fees or limit access to verified technicians, frustrating DIY owners. Language and unit variations across global listings can cause ordering errors. Compatibility with legacy electronic systems—such as NMEA 0183 vs. NMEA 2000—is not always clearly flagged.
- Data freshness: how recently a part listing or supersession was updated.
- Verification of aftermarket quality ratings and return policies.
- Privacy: some directories require boat registration or hull ID to search.
Likely Impact
Widespread adoption of comprehensive directories could reduce downtime for boat repairs, particularly in remote areas where local dealers are scarce. Standardized cross-referencing may lower the cost of sourcing non-OEM parts, but could also pressure small marine retailers who rely on exclusive brand ties. For repair shops, a directory shortens diagnostic time when trying to match a worn component by visual or dimensional clues. For insurers, accurate parts identification can speed claim approvals.
- Shorter lead times for hard-to-find parts if directories link to multiple distributors.
- Risk of relying on incomplete or crowd-sourced data without professional validation.
- Potential for directory platforms to offer integrated ordering, creating market consolidation.
What to Watch Next
Industry observers expect marine parts directories to add more structured data compatibility with boat builder CAD files and exploded parts diagrams. Watch for pilot programs allowing direct part ordering through the directory interface, bypassing dealer tiers. Also monitor how regulatory bodies (e.g., US Coast Guard or European Recreational Craft Directive) may influence directory standards for safety-critical components like steering or fuel systems. The emergence of “open” directories vs. proprietary OEM portals will be a key factor in long-term user trust.
- Integration of augmented reality to overlay part numbers on a live camera view of an engine bay.
- Partnerships between directories and boating membership organizations for exclusive access.
- Efforts to create a universal part identification system similar to the automotive VIN-based lookup.
